Dramatic Rescue: British Citizen Freed from Ecuador Kidnappers

British millionaire Colin Armstrong, 78, was rescued by Ecuadorian police after being kidnapped by a gang who demanded protection money. The police released a video showing their cars racing to rescue Armstrong, and later raided a farmhouse, confiscating weapons, explosives, vehicles, and drugs. Armstrong's girlfriend, who was also abducted, was found wearing a fake explosive vest. Police suspect she may have been involved in the kidnapping. Nine suspects have been arrested, including one foreigner. The Los Tiguerones gang, linked to the violent Mexican cartel CJNG, is believed to be responsible for the kidnapping. Armstrong's son and daughter expressed relief at his safe release. Ecuador has seen a rise in violence and drug-related crime in recent years.
